Museum
The Casa natal de Goya is an historical house museum in , , where renowned artist Francisco Goya was born in 1746. It is, since 1989, a house museum, that preserves reproductions of artworks and documents from Goya, and also objects and furniture of Aragonese style. is situated 4 km southwest of Paridera Balsa Nueva.
